Why the Keychron Q1 HE is trending among gamers
The gaming community in Singapore has shifted its focus toward Hall Effect (HE) magnetic switches. The Keychron Q1 HE is at the center of this transition because it offers Rapid Trigger technology. This feature allows for near-instant key resets, which provides a massive advantage in competitive titles like Valorant or Counter-Strike 2. Unlike traditional mechanical switches, these magnetic sensors are incredibly durable and highly customizable.

Shipping estimates and package specifications
The Keychron Q1 HE is a solid piece of hardware. It features a full CNC aluminum body, which means it has significant weight compared to plastic alternatives. Understanding the physical profile of the box helps you estimate shipping cost accurately before you hit the checkout button.
| Metric | Estimate |
|---|---|
| Box Weight | Approx. 5.2 lbs (2.35 kg) |
| Box Dimensions | Medium (Approx. 38cm x 18cm x 8cm) |
| Battery Content | Contains a 4000 mAh Lithium Battery |
Volumetric Warning: This item is relatively dense, so you likely won't be hit by high volumetric weight charges. However, always check if you are adding extra large desk mats to your order, as those can increase the box size significantly.
Battery Check: Since the Q1 HE is a wireless keyboard, it contains a lithium-ion battery. Most international shipping service providers have specific protocols for items with batteries. Fortunately, keyboards are generally easy to clear as long as the battery is installed within the device.
